[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Titanium IV: XFree86.0.log: "(II) RADEON(0): Direct rendering disabled"



Hi All

unstable here.

Today I compiled and installed the latest 
drm-trunk-module-src 2004.02.28-1 

When I boot to 2.4.24-ben1 Direct rendering seems to be disabled here.
And I'd like to understand why.

When I boot to my old backup kernel  2.4.22-ben2 everything seems fine,
Direct Rendering seems to be on. This old kernel seems to work with old
drm-trunk-module-src
modules.

Machine type, stuff installed: at the end of this mail.

This is a diff between /var/log/XFree86.0.log
for booting 2.4.22-ben2 and /var/log/XFree86.0.log.old for 2.4.24-ben1


-------------------------------------------
*** /var/log/XFree86.0.log	Tue Mar  2 20:01:09 2004
--- /var/log/XFree86.0.log.old	Tue Mar  2 19:44:16 2004
***************
*** 9,15 ****
  Release Date: 10 September 2003
  X Protocol Version 11, Revision 0, Release 6.6
  Build Operating System: Linux 2.6.3-ben1-ck1 ppc [ELF] 
! Current Operating System: Linux debby 2.4.22-ben2 #1 Sun Oct 5 21:10:37 CEST 2003 ppc
  Build Date: 01 March 2004
  Changelog Date: 10 September 2003
  	Before reporting problems, check http://www.XFree86.Org/
--- 9,15 ----
  Release Date: 10 September 2003
  X Protocol Version 11, Revision 0, Release 6.6
  Build Operating System: Linux 2.6.3-ben1-ck1 ppc [ELF] 
! Current Operating System: Linux debby 2.4.24-ben1 #1 Mon Feb 23 00:17:45 CET 2004 ppc
  Build Date: 01 March 2004
  Changelog Date: 10 September 2003
  	Before reporting problems, check http://www.XFree86.Org/
***************
*** 18,24 ****
  Markers: (--) probed, (**) from config file, (==) default setting,
  	(++) from command line, (!!) notice, (II) informational,
  	(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
! (==) Log file: "/var/log/XFree86.0.log", Time: Tue Mar  2 19:46:09 2004
  (==) Using config file: "/etc/X11/XF86Config-4"
  (==) ServerLayout "Default Layout"
  (**) |-->Screen "Default Screen" (0)
--- 18,24 ----
  Markers: (--) probed, (**) from config file, (==) default setting,
  	(++) from command line, (!!) notice, (II) informational,
  	(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
! (==) Log file: "/var/log/XFree86.0.log", Time: Tue Mar  2 19:44:12 2004
  (==) Using config file: "/etc/X11/XF86Config-4"
  (==) ServerLayout "Default Layout"
  (**) |-->Screen "Default Screen" (0)
***************
*** 548,560 ****
  	[18] 0	0	0x000003b0 - 0x000003bb (0xc) IS[B](OprU)
  	[19] 0	0	0x000003c0 - 0x000003df (0x20) IS[B](OprU)
  drmOpenDevice: node name is /dev/dri/card0
! drmOpenDevice: open result is -1, (No such device)
! drmOpenDevice: open result is -1, (No such device)
! drmOpenDevice: Open failed
  drmOpenDevice: node name is /dev/dri/card0
! drmOpenDevice: open result is -1, (No such device)
! drmOpenDevice: open result is -1, (No such device)
! drmOpenDevice: Open failed
  drmOpenByBusid: Searching for BusID pci:0000:00:10.0
  drmOpenDevice: node name is /dev/dri/card0
  drmOpenDevice: open result is 8, (OK)
--- 548,556 ----
  	[18] 0	0	0x000003b0 - 0x000003bb (0xc) IS[B](OprU)
  	[19] 0	0	0x000003c0 - 0x000003df (0x20) IS[B](OprU)
  drmOpenDevice: node name is /dev/dri/card0
! drmOpenDevice: open result is 8, (OK)
  drmOpenDevice: node name is /dev/dri/card0
! drmOpenDevice: open result is 8, (OK)
  drmOpenByBusid: Searching for BusID pci:0000:00:10.0
  drmOpenDevice: node name is /dev/dri/card0
  drmOpenDevice: open result is 8, (OK)
***************
*** 635,670 ****
  drmOpenDevice: node name is /dev/dri/card0
  drmOpenDevice: open result is 8, (OK)
  drmGetBusid returned ''
- (II) RADEON(0): [drm] loaded kernel module for "radeon" driver
  (II) RADEON(0): [drm] DRM interface version 1.0
! (II) RADEON(0): [drm] created "radeon" driver at busid "pci:0000:00:10.0"
! (II) RADEON(0): [drm] added 8192 byte SAREA at 0xf303d000
! (II) RADEON(0): [drm] mapped SAREA 0xf303d000 to 0x3001a000
! (II) RADEON(0): [drm] framebuffer handle = 0xb8000000
! (II) RADEON(0): [drm] added 1 reserved context for kernel
! (II) RADEON(0): [agp] Mode 0x07000207 [AGP 0x106b/0x002d; Card 0x1002/0x4c66]
! (II) RADEON(0): [agp] 16384 kB allocated with handle 0x00000001
! (II) RADEON(0): [agp] ring handle = 0x00000000
! (II) RADEON(0): [agp] Ring mapped at 0x320c7000
! (II) RADEON(0): [agp] ring read ptr handle = 0x00101000
! (II) RADEON(0): [agp] Ring read ptr mapped at 0x3001c000
! (II) RADEON(0): [agp] vertex/indirect buffers handle = 0x00102000
! (II) RADEON(0): [agp] Vertex/indirect buffers mapped at 0x321c8000
! (II) RADEON(0): [agp] GART texture map handle = 0x00302000
! (II) RADEON(0): [agp] GART Texture map mapped at 0x323c8000
! (II) RADEON(0): [drm] register handle = 0xb0000000
! (II) RADEON(0): [dri] Visual configs initialized
! (II) RADEON(0): CP in BM mode
! (II) RADEON(0): Using 16 MB GART aperture
! (II) RADEON(0): Using 1 MB for the ring buffer
! (II) RADEON(0): Using 2 MB for vertex/indirect buffers
! (II) RADEON(0): Using 13 MB for GART textures
  (II) RADEON(0): Memory manager initialized to (0,0) (1280,6553)
  (II) RADEON(0): Reserved area from (0,854) to (1280,856)
  (II) RADEON(0): Largest offscreen area available: 1280 x 5697
- (II) RADEON(0): Will use back buffer at offset 0x85c000
- (II) RADEON(0): Will use depth buffer at offset 0xc88000
- (II) RADEON(0): Will use 15616 kb for textures at offset 0x10c0000
  (II) RADEON(0): Using XFree86 Acceleration Architecture (XAA)
  	Screen to screen bit blits
  	Solid filled rectangles
--- 631,642 ----
  drmOpenDevice: node name is /dev/dri/card0
  drmOpenDevice: open result is 8, (OK)
  drmGetBusid returned ''
  (II) RADEON(0): [drm] DRM interface version 1.0
! (II) RADEON(0): [drm] drmSetBusid failed (8, pci:0000:00:10.0), Permission denied
! (EE) RADEON(0): [dri] DRIScreenInit failed.  Disabling DRI.
  (II) RADEON(0): Memory manager initialized to (0,0) (1280,6553)
  (II) RADEON(0): Reserved area from (0,854) to (1280,856)
  (II) RADEON(0): Largest offscreen area available: 1280 x 5697
  (II) RADEON(0): Using XFree86 Acceleration Architecture (XAA)
  	Screen to screen bit blits
  	Solid filled rectangles
***************
*** 684,697 ****
  (II) RADEON(0): Largest offscreen area available: 1280 x 5693
  (**) Option "dpms"
  (**) RADEON(0): DPMS enabled
! (II) RADEON(0): X context handle = 0x00000001
! (II) RADEON(0): [drm] installed DRM signal handler
! (II) RADEON(0): [DRI] installation complete
! (II) RADEON(0): [drm] Added 32 65536 byte vertex/indirect buffers
! (II) RADEON(0): [drm] Mapped 32 vertex/indirect buffers
! (II) RADEON(0): [drm] dma control initialized, using IRQ 48
! (II) RADEON(0): [drm] Initialized kernel GART heap manager, 13369344
! (II) RADEON(0): Direct rendering enabled
  (==) RandR enabled
  (II) Initializing built-in extension MIT-SHM
  (II) Initializing built-in extension XInputExtension
--- 656,662 ----
  (II) RADEON(0): Largest offscreen area available: 1280 x 5693
  (**) Option "dpms"
  (**) RADEON(0): DPMS enabled
! (II) RADEON(0): Direct rendering disabled
  (==) RandR enabled
  (II) Initializing built-in extension MIT-SHM
  (II) Initializing built-in extension XInputExtension
***************
*** 727,737 ****
  Warning: font renderer for ".bdf.Z" already registered at priority 0
  Warning: font renderer for ".bdf.gz" already registered at priority 0
  Warning: font renderer for ".pmf" already registered at priority 0
- (II) Open APM successful
- (II) RADEON(0): [RESUME] Attempting to re-init Radeon hardware.
- (II) RADEON(0): [agp] Mode 0x07000207 [AGP 0x106b/0x002d; Card 0x1002/0x4c66]
- (II) Configured Mouse: ps2EnableDataReporting: succeeded
- GetModeLine - scrn: 0 clock: 79810
- GetModeLine - hdsp: 1280 hbeg: 1296 hend: 1408 httl: 1536
-               vdsp: 854 vbeg: 855 vend: 858 vttl: 866 flags: -2147483648
- (II) 3rd Button detected: disabling emulate3Button
--- 692,694 ----


--------------------------------------------

Trying to find the package differences between 
drm-trunk-module-2.4.22-ben 2003.10.05 and
drm-trunk-module-2.4.24-ben 2004.02.28-1:

--------------------------------

 locate radeon.o
/lib/modules/2.4.22-ben2/kernel/drivers/char/drm/radeon.o
/lib/modules/2.4.24-ben1/kernel/drivers/char/drm/radeon.o

$ dpkg -S /lib/modules/2.4.22-ben2/kernel/drivers/char/drm/radeon.o
drm-trunk-module-2.4.22-ben2: /lib/modules/2.4.22-ben2/kernel/drivers/char/drm/radeon.o

$ dpkg -S /lib/modules/2.4.24-ben1/kernel/drivers/char/drm/radeon.o
diversion by drm-trunk-module-2.4.24-ben1 from: /lib/modules/2.4.24-ben1/kernel/drivers/char/drm/radeon.o
diversion by drm-trunk-module-2.4.24-ben1 to: /lib/modules/2.4.24-ben1/kernel/drivers/char/drm/radeon.o.kernel
drm-trunk-module-2.4.24-ben1: /lib/modules/2.4.24-ben1/kernel/drivers/char/drm/radeon.o
$ 

ls -l /lib/modules/2.4.24-ben1/kernel/drivers/char/drm/radeon.o.kernel
ls: /lib/modules/2.4.24-ben1/kernel/drivers/char/drm/radeon.o.kernel: No such file or directory


----------------------------------


I know some package (drm-related ?)got uninstalled about 2 weeks ago
when upgdrading packages, but I forgot which one:

It might be it was 
xlibmesa-gl1-dri-trunk 2003.10.05-2
which was replaced by
xlibmesa-gl, but I'm not sure:

aptitude in its interface, when viewing the details for xlibmesa-gl says
(among other things):

--
i A   4.3.0-2
p     xlibmesa-gl1-dri-trunk 2003.10.05-2
p     xlibmesa-gl1-dri-trunk 2004.02.28-1

i A 4.3.0-2
p   xlibmesa-gl1-dri-trunk 2003.10.05-2
--
what ever this means: was xlibmesa-gl1-dri-trunk 2003.10.05-2
purged, does it have to be purged
if xlibmesa-gl will be installed: It's not clear for me ...

This is what I have: 
 COLUMNS=122 dpkg -l | grep xlibmesa
ii  xlibmesa-dri             4.3.0-2              Mesa 3D graphics library modules [XFree86]
ii  xlibmesa-gl              4.3.0-2               Mesa 3D graphics library [XFree86]
ii  xlibmesa-gl-dev          4.3.0-2         Mesa 3D graphics library development files [XFree86]
rc  xlibmesa-gl1-dri-trunk   2003.10.05-2        Mesa 3D graphics library [DRI trunk]
ii  xlibmesa-glu             4.3.0-2                  Mesa OpenGL utility library [XFree86]
ii  xlibmesa-glu-dev         4.3.0-2      Mesa OpenGL utility library development files [XFree86]
ii  xlibmesa3                4.3.0-2                  XFree86 Mesa libraries pseudopackage
ic  xlibmesa3-dri-trunk    2002.12.05-4       DRI CVS trunk version of Mesa 3D graphics library
ic  xlibmesa3-gl             4.2.1-12.1               Mesa 3D graphics library [XFree86]
rc  xlibmesa3-glu            4.2.1-16                 Mesa OpenGL utility library [XFree86]
-- 

4th column is cut in the following output:
COLUMNS=132 dpkg -l | grep drm-trunk 
ii  drm-trunk-module-2.4.22-ben 2003.10.05-1+10.00.Custom
ii  drm-trunk-module-2.4.24-ben 2004.02.28-1
ii  drm-trunk-module-src        2004.02.28-1

$ cat /proc/cpuinfo 
cpu             : 7455, altivec supported
clock           : 667MHz
revision        : 3.2 (pvr 8001 0302)
bogomips        : 665.19
machine         : PowerBook3,5
motherboard     : PowerBook3,5 MacRISC2 MacRISC Power Macintosh
board revision  : 00000000
detected as     : 80 (PowerBook Titanium IV)
pmac flags      : 0000000b
L2 cache        : 256K unified
memory          : 768MB
pmac-generation : NewWorld

Thanks in anticipation

Best Regards
Wolfgang
-- 
Profile, Links: http://profiles.yahoo.com/wolfgangpfeiffer



Reply to: